This morning I went out to feed and check on my animals and 9 of my chickens where dead. Three were alive. They usually get locked up at night, but the coop was mistakenly left open. I found them sprawled out from one end of the yard to the other. Two of them where in the goat pen next to where there coop is, but was more that a 50 yards away. Crazy wierd. No part was eating except the heads where taken off, laying just a foot away. Three heads I couldn't find. One chicken had no blood, head intact and was just dead. I was horrified, and still mind boggled over it....about a month ago I had three other chickens get attacked different days. They had completely different signs of death, half eatin and feathers off. I set traps and caught two foxes and a skunk. The foxes I discovered where living under my work shop. I have no idea what got my chickens this time, but I know its a different animal. Im thinking bigger to, my chickens where large and healthy. I am just so so sad.
